What Types of Machines are Available for Cleaning Mattresses?

There are several types of machines available for cleaning mattresses, each designed to tackle specific cleaning challenges.

  • Vacuum Cleaners: Standard or specialized vacuum cleaners are essential for removing dust, dirt, and allergens from mattress surfaces.
  • Steam Cleaners: These machines use high-temperature steam to sanitize and deep clean mattresses, effectively killing bacteria and dust mites.
  • Upholstery Cleaners: These machines are specifically designed for deep cleaning fabric surfaces, making them ideal for mattresses with removable covers.
  • Portable Carpet Cleaners: Compact and easy to use, these cleaners often have attachments that allow for effective cleaning of mattresses while providing powerful suction and scrubbing action.
  • Dry Cleaning Machines: These machines use a dry cleaning solution to remove stains and odors from mattresses without the need for excessive moisture.

Vacuum cleaners are a fundamental tool for mattress maintenance, as they can easily remove loose dirt and allergens. Many models come with specialized attachments designed to reach crevices and corners, making them effective for keeping mattresses dust-free.

Steam cleaners offer a deep cleaning solution, utilizing hot steam to penetrate fabrics and kill harmful microorganisms. This method is particularly beneficial for sanitizing mattresses and removing stubborn stains without the use of harsh chemicals.

Upholstery cleaners are designed to tackle the specific needs of fabric cleaning. They often feature various cleaning modes and brushes that help lift dirt and stains from the mattress fibers, making them a versatile choice for maintaining cleanliness.

Portable carpet cleaners are popular for their convenience and efficiency. These compact machines can be easily maneuvered to clean mattresses and typically come with a range of attachments for enhanced cleaning power, including brushes for scrubbing and nozzles for precise application of cleaning solutions.

Dry cleaning machines are an innovative option that employs a solvent-based cleaning solution to treat mattresses. This method is particularly useful for sensitive fabrics that may be damaged by water, effectively lifting stains and odors while ensuring the mattress dries quickly.

How Do Steam Cleaners Work for Mattress Cleaning?

Steam cleaners are effective tools for cleaning mattresses by utilizing high-temperature steam to sanitize and remove dirt and allergens.

  • High-Temperature Steam: Steam cleaners heat water to produce steam that can reach temperatures of up to 250°F. This high temperature helps to kill dust mites, bacteria, and other allergens embedded in the mattress fibers, making it a highly effective cleaning method.
  • Pressurized Spray: The steam is typically expelled through a nozzle at high pressure, allowing it to penetrate deep into the mattress material. This pressurized application ensures that the steam reaches hard-to-clean areas, loosening dirt and debris for easy removal.
  • Chemical-Free Cleaning: One of the significant advantages of using a steam cleaner is that it often does not require the use of harsh chemicals. The power of steam alone can effectively clean and sanitize without introducing potentially harmful substances into your sleeping environment.
  • Attachments and Accessories: Many steam cleaners come with various attachments, such as brushes or upholstery tools, specifically designed for cleaning mattresses. These accessories enhance the cleaning process by providing better agitation and allowing for more focused cleaning on specific spots or stains.
  • Quick Drying Time: Since steam evaporates quickly, mattresses cleaned with a steam cleaner typically dry faster than those cleaned with water and detergent methods. This quick drying reduces the risk of mold and mildew developing in the mattress due to prolonged dampness.

What Features Should You Consider When Choosing a Mattress Cleaning Machine?

When choosing the best machine to clean a mattress, several key features should be considered to ensure effective cleaning and ease of use.

  • Type of Cleaning Method: Consider whether the machine uses steam cleaning, shampooing, or dry cleaning methods. Steam cleaning is effective for deep sanitation and can eliminate dust mites and allergens, while shampooing may be better for stain removal.
  • Portability: Look for a machine that is lightweight and easy to maneuver. A portable machine will enable you to reach different areas of the mattress without hassle, making the cleaning process more efficient.
  • Tank Capacity: Check the size of the water or cleaning solution tank. A larger tank capacity means less frequent refilling, which is beneficial for cleaning larger mattresses or multiple surfaces without interruption.
  • Versatility: Choose a machine that can also clean upholstery or carpets. This versatility allows you to use the same equipment for various cleaning tasks around the home, providing better value.
  • Attachments and Accessories: Evaluate the included attachments, such as upholstery brushes or crevice tools. These accessories can enhance the machine’s cleaning capabilities, allowing for a more thorough clean in tight or intricate areas.
  • Noise Level: Consider the noise level of the machine during operation. A quieter machine will make the cleaning process less disruptive, especially if you are cleaning during times when others are at home.
  • Drying Time: Look for machines that have quick-drying capabilities. Fast drying is essential to prevent mold and mildew growth on the mattress after cleaning.
  • Ease of Use: Assess how user-friendly the machine is, including its controls and maintenance requirements. A straightforward operation will save time and effort, making it easier to clean your mattress regularly.
  • Warranty and Customer Support: Check for a good warranty and reliable customer support. A solid warranty can protect your investment, while responsive customer support can help resolve any issues that arise.

What is the Ideal Cleaning Schedule for Maintaining a Healthy Mattress?

Maintaining a healthy mattress involves adhering to a regular cleaning schedule to prevent allergens, dust mites, and odors from accumulating. Here’s an ideal cleaning routine:

  • Weekly: Vacuuming the mattress with an upholstery attachment helps remove dust and debris. Flip the mattress if it’s double-sided, to ensure even wear.

  • Monthly: Spot clean any stains immediately with a mild detergent diluted in water or a specialized mattress cleaner. Check for any signs of wear or damage during this time.

  • Seasonally: Wash mattress covers or mattress protectors according to the manufacturer’s instructions. This deters allergens and extends the life of your mattress.

  • Biannually: Deep clean the mattress using a steam cleaner or a specialized mattress cleaning machine. This process eliminates deep-seated dirt and bacteria.

  • Annually: Consider sanitizing or rotating your mattress if possible, and assess its condition to determine if replacement is needed.

Following this cleaning schedule ensures a hygienic sleeping environment and prolongs the life of your mattress.
